The Hunt for Red October by Tom Clancy

Tom Clancy is a master of military fiction, and “The Hunt for Red October” is one of his most beloved and thrilling novels. The story follows Jack Ryan, a CIA analyst who must track down a rogue Soviet submarine before it can trigger a nuclear war. Filled with tense submarine battles, political intrigue, and high-stakes espionage, this book is a must-read for fans of the genre.

Black Hawk Down by Mark Bowden

“Black Hawk Down” tells the true story of a 1993 US military mission in Somalia gone horribly wrong. When two Black Hawk helicopters are shot down during a raid on a Somali warlord, a small group of American soldiers must fight for their lives behind enemy lines. This gripping and intense book is a harrowing account of bravery, sacrifice, and survival in the face of overwhelming odds.

Red Storm Rising by Tom Clancy

Another classic from Tom Clancy, “Red Storm Rising” is a sprawling epic that imagines a future conflict between NATO and the Soviet Union. As the two superpowers clash in a global war, soldiers on both sides must brave incredible dangers behind enemy lines. Packed with intense battle scenes, intricate strategy, and a vast cast of characters, this book is a must-read for fans of military fiction.

Bravo Two Zero by Andy McNab

Andy McNab is a former SAS soldier, and “Bravo Two Zero” is his gripping and harrowing account of a failed mission in the Gulf War. When McNab’s patrol is ambushed deep in Iraqi territory, he and his comrades must fight their way back to safety through enemy territory. This brutally honest and intense book offers a rare glimpse into the world of special forces operations and the brutal realities of warfare.
